DIY EMF Detection: Using a Handheld Meter

Want to assess electromagnetic emissions in your home without spending a fortune ? A handheld EMF meter can be a remarkably effective tool . These reasonably low-cost devices often show EMF readings in units like microteslas (µT) or milligauss (mG). To start your own investigation, locate a still spot and switch off nearby electronics as much as feasible. Then, slowly move the sensor of the meter near different areas – surfaces , wiring outlets, and nearby transmitters – to identify any notable EMF sources . Remember to read the meter's manual for specific operation and guidelines information.
